3 years and nothing but problems - and no service from the manufacturer
We have this grill, but in fairness, we did not buy from Amazon, we bought it from a local dealer - who at the time recommended this as a good solid grill that was not as expensive as other ones. Since we have bought this - the local deal NO LONGER CARRIER this brand due to the issues and their distributor no longer carries it either. So buy beware. We have had it for around 3 years and have had nothing but issues, and none of these have been addressed by Swiss. You will see below that clearly we are not the only ones to have an issue since they are making a 'custom' part (if we ever see it) to fix it. Our issue started within the 1st 2 months, the firebox expands and as a result the middle grills itself collapses down, putting everything extremely close to the heat and causing flare ups if there is any fat (its a steak.. of course there could be). We had this corrected by them coming out. Well we thought it was corrected. It started happening again and we have reached out to them and have had no actual service what so ever. S**N
You get what you pay for-save your money
I bought this unit 2 months ago. It looks like the real deal, nice shine and similar to the expensive brand units. I used it less than 20 times in this summer. I have it outside on the deck. No rain or extreme humidity yet. I converted the unit to natural gas yesterday and to my surprise when I started to take it apart I found my new grill parts inside in an advanced of degradation. They are rusted pretty bad for a 2 month unit. My inexpensive previous grill from Home Depot lasted longer. I was very disappointed when I tried to remove the burners and I did not succeeded until I cut it the pins that hold them in place. They rusted so badly that I could not remove them. I guess I got what I payed for. I would not recommend this product.
